Rhododendron Pruning in Aiken, SC
Rhododendron p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ping these flowering shrubs to promote healthy growth, enhance their appearance, and maintain the desired size and form. This type of pruning can address overgrown or unruly plants, remove dead or diseased branches, and encourage more abundant blooms. Projects typically range from light shaping and thinning to more extensive cuts for rejuvenation, ensuring the rhododendron remains a vibrant and attractive feature in the landscape.
Homeowners interested in rhododendron pruning should consider factors such as the plant’s age, size, and flowering cycle before requesting services. It’s important to understand the best times of year for pruning to avoid damaging the plant or reducing flowering potential. Additionally, knowing the specific variety and growth habits can help determine the appropriate pruning techniques to achieve the desired aesthetic and health benefits for the shrub.

Rhododendron Pruning Questions
Why is rhododendron pruning important? Proper pruning helps maintain the plant’s shape, encourages healthy growth, and promotes vibrant blooms each season.
When is the best time to prune rhododendrons? The ideal time is shortly after flowering, typically in late spring or early summer, to support healthy development.
How much should be removed during pruning? Only dead, damaged, or overgrown branches should be cut back to preserve the plant’s natural form and health.
Can pruning improve the appearance of my rhododendron? Yes, strategic pruning can enhance its shape, density, and overall visual appeal on the property.
